3 Smart Thermostat Tips for Homeowners in Dalzell, SC

If you install a smart thermostat in your Dalzell, SC, home, it should improve your HVAC efficiency and your comfort. However, it can only do that if you use it properly. Here are three smart thermostat tips to maximize their benefits.

1. Set In-Depth Schedules

One of the most valuable features of a smart thermostat is that it lets you set precise comfort schedules. The more information about your schedule you provide, the better the thermostat can optimize your heating and cooling system efficiency. So, the first thing you should do is set in-depth schedules on your smart thermostat.

Begin by setting your thermostat to change the temperature when you typically go to sleep and wake. Then, program a setback temperature when you’re usually out of your home for work or other regular events. Your goal is to create large time blocks with minimal temperature changes.

2. Enable Geofencing

Many smart thermostats can use the GPS data from your smartphone to tell when you’re home. You can set your smart thermostat to track your comings and goings and adjust temperatures appropriately. That can improve your energy savings if you keep an irregular schedule.

3. Review Energy Usage Data

Smart thermostats can often collect data about your HVAC energy usage. The purpose is to help you understand how and when you use the most energy. Learning how to use your smart thermostat’s energy reporting and analysis functions is essential.

Many smart thermostats will make setting recommendations based on the data they collect. Following those recommendations or letting your smart thermostat automatically apply them should maximize your energy savings.
